本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网的飞速发展,服务器端口安全问题日益凸显,关闭服务器端口是保障网络安全的重要措施之一,本文将详细解析如何关闭服务器端口,帮助您更好地保护您的服务器。
服务器端口概述
服务器端口是服务器与客户端之间通信的桥梁,用于区分不同的网络服务,常见的服务器端口有80(HTTP)、443(HTTPS)、21(FTP)等,关闭不必要的端口,可以降低服务器被攻击的风险。
关闭服务器端口的方法
1、操作系统层面
(1)Windows系统
在Windows系统中,可以通过以下步骤关闭服务器端口:
步骤一:打开“控制面板”,点击“系统与安全”,选择“Windows Defender 防火墙”。
步骤二:在左侧导航栏中,点击“允许的应用或功能通过Windows Defender 防火墙”。
步骤三:在右侧窗口中,找到需要关闭端口的程序,点击“更改设置”。
步骤四:取消勾选“允许此应用或功能通过Windows Defender 防火墙”,点击“确定”。
(2)Linux系统
在Linux系统中,可以通过以下步骤关闭服务器端口:
步骤一:登录服务器,使用root权限。
图片来源于网络,如有侵权联系删除
步骤二:编辑防火墙配置文件(如iptables或firewalld),例如使用iptables:
iptables -A INPUT -p tcp --dport 端口号 -j DROP
步骤三:重启防火墙服务,例如使用systemctl:
systemctl restart iptables
2、应用层面
(1)Web服务器
对于Web服务器(如Apache、Nginx等),可以通过以下步骤关闭服务器端口:
步骤一:打开Web服务器配置文件(如httpd.conf或nginx.conf)。
步骤二:找到Listen指令,修改端口号。
步骤三:重启Web服务器。
(2)FTP服务器
对于FTP服务器(如vsftpd、proftpd等),可以通过以下步骤关闭服务器端口:
步骤一:打开FTP服务器配置文件(如vsftpd.conf或proftpd.conf)。
步骤二:找到listen指令,修改端口号。
图片来源于网络,如有侵权联系删除
步骤三:重启FTP服务器。
3、网络设备层面
对于网络设备(如路由器、交换机等),可以通过以下步骤关闭服务器端口:
步骤一:登录网络设备,进入配置界面。
步骤二:找到端口过滤或访问控制列表(ACL)设置。
步骤三:添加规则,拒绝指定端口的访问。
注意事项
1、关闭端口前,请确保该端口不是您所需的服务端口。
2、关闭端口后,可能导致相关服务无法正常使用,请提前做好备份和恢复工作。
3、定期检查服务器端口,及时关闭不必要的端口,降低安全风险。
关闭服务器端口是保障网络安全的重要措施,通过本文的解析,相信您已经掌握了关闭服务器端口的方法,在实际操作过程中,请根据自身需求选择合适的方法,确保服务器安全稳定运行。
标签: #如何关闭服务器的端口
评论列表